Why is congress interested in the seat formula?


Congress sources claim that the party is standing up and requesting seats from allies in five states, including UP-Bihar. The party is attempting to maintain the greatest number of seats inside its ranks by using this tactic.

There is a struggle about seat distribution among the 28 indian Alliance parties prior to the announcement of lok sabha elections. The congress party has nominated five prominent figures, including ashok gehlot and Mukul Wasnik, to address the problem of seat distribution in the alliance. congress sources claim that the party is campaigning in Uttar Pradesh, Bihar, bengal, Maharashtra, and tamil Nadu and is asking allies for seats. This is due to two primary factors:

1. The party's organization in these states is incredibly disorganized. The party has no organization in many parts of bengal and Bihar. For the past two years, the party has been unable to select a new president for Bengal.

2. By presenting a strong front, congress India hopes to secure as many alliance seats as possible, which will facilitate the execution of its 300-seat agenda. Experts predict that during the seat agreement using data-face formula, congress will pick up at least 20 seats in 5 states.
